2. Conduct a Comprehensive SEO Audit


Before implementing any changes, assess your current SEO performance. A thorough audit will help you identify strengths, weaknesses, and opportunities. Key areas to evaluate include:


  1. Technical SEO: Check for crawl errors, site speed, mobile-friendliness, and indexability.
  2. On-Page SEO: Analyze title tags, meta descriptions, headers, and keyword usage.
  3. Off-Page SEO: Review backlinks, domain authority, and social signals.
  4. Content Quality: Assess readability, relevance, and engagement metrics.


Tools to Use: Google Search Console, SEMrush, Ahrefs, Screaming Frog.


3. Keyword Research and Strategy


Keyword research is the foundation of SEO. It helps you understand what your audience is searching for and how to align your content with their intent.


Steps to Follow:


  1.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, or Ubersuggest to find high-volume, low-competition keywords.
  2. Focus on long-tail keywords (e.g., “best SEO tools for small businesses”) that are easier to rank for and have higher conversion potential.
  3. Analyze search intent (informational, navigational, transactional) and create content that matches it.
  4. Stat: Pages targeting long-tail keywords generate 3x more traffic than those targeting short-tail keywords (Source: Backlinko).

4. Optimize On-Page SEO Elements


On-page SEO ensures that your content is optimized for both users and search engines. 
Key elements to focus on include:

  1. Title Tags: Include primary keywords and keep them under 60 characters.
  2. Meta Descriptions: Write compelling summaries with a call-to-action (CTA).
  3. Headers (H1, H2, H3): Use keywords naturally and structure content for readability
  4. URL Structure: Keep URLs short, descriptive, and keyword-rich.
  5. Internal Linking: Link to relevant pages to improve navigation and distribute link equity.


Pro Tip: Use schema markup to enhance your search snippets with rich results (e.g., star ratings, FAQs).

6. Build a Strong Backlink Profile


Backlinks are a critical ranking factor, as they signal to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.

Link-Building Strategies:


  1. Create shareable content (e.g., infographics, case studies, guides).

  2. Reach out to industry influencers and bloggers for collaborations.

  3. Submit guest posts to authoritative websites in your niche.

  4. Use tools like Ahrefs or Moz to monitor your backlink profile and disavow toxic links.


Stat: Pages with more backlinks tend to rank higher on Google. In fact, the #1 result in Google has an average of 3.8x more backlinks than positions #2–#10 (Source: Backlinko).

7. Optimize for Mobile and Core Web Vitals


With 58% of global website traffic coming from mobile devices (Source: Statista), mobile optimization is no longer optional.


Key Areas to Focus On:


  1. Ensure your website is responsive and loads quickly on all devices.
  2. Optimize for Core Web Vitals, which include:
  3. Largest Contentful Paint (LCP): Load time for the main content.
  4. First Input Delay (FID): Time it takes for the page to become interactive
  5.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S): Visual stability of the page.


Pro Tip: Use Google’s PageSpeed Insights to identify and fix performance issues.


8. Leverage Local SEO (If Applicable)


For businesses with a physical presence, local SEO is crucial for attracting nearby customers.


Local SEO Best Practices:


  1. Claim and optimize your Google Business Profile.
  2. Use location-based keywords (e.g., “SEO services in New York”).
  3. Encourage customers to leave reviews and respond to them promptly.
  4. Build citations on local directories (e.g., Yelp, Yellow Pages).
  5. Stat: 46% of all Google searches have local intent (Source: GoGulf).

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Your SEO Roadmap


While following the roadmap, beware of these common pitfalls:


  1. Keyword Stuffing: Overloading content with keywords can lead to penalties.
  2. Ignoring Technical SEO: Even the best content won’t rank if your site has technical issues.
  3. Neglecting User Experience: Google prioritizes sites that offer a seamless user experience.
  4. Focusing Only on Rankings: Traffic and conversions are more important than rankings alone.
